8199882: compiler/uncommontrap/TestDeoptOOM.java failed w/ fatal error: ExceptionMark constructor expects no pending exceptions

Pre-load AbstractOwnableSynchronizer class instead of lazy loading it.

Reviewed-by: sspitsyn, cjplummer, coleenp
